随着互联网的发展,电子邮件已经成为人们沟通交流的重要工具之一。SMTP(Simple Mail Transfer Protocol,简单邮件传输协议)是用于发送电子邮件的应用层协议。我们将介绍如何在Windows、Linux和MacOS等不同的操作系统上配置SMTP服务器客户端。
Windows系统上的SMTP服务器客户端配置
一、检查内置服务
Windows Server 2016/2019及以上版本自带了SMTP服务,但默认情况下没有安装。要启用它,需要通过“添加角色和功能向导”进行安装。对于Windows 10或更早版本的用户来说,可以使用第三方应用程序如Mail Enable、hMailServer来实现SMTP功能。
二、使用PowerShell命令行
如果您选择的是Windows Server系统,那么可以考虑使用PowerShell来简化配置过程。例如:使用“Install-WindowsFeature SMTP-Server”命令安装SMTP服务;使用“Set-SMTPServerSetting -Name -MaxMessageSize 20MB”修改最大消息大小为20MB等。
三、配置防火墙规则
确保Windows防火墙允许SMTP流量。可以通过创建入站规则以开放TCP端口25来实现这一点。
Linux系统上的SMTP服务器客户端配置
一、安装Postfix
Postfix是一种广泛使用的开源SMTP服务器软件。大多数Linux发行版都提供了Postfix软件包,可以直接从官方源中获取并安装。
二、编辑主配置文件
Postfix的主要配置文件位于/etc/postfix/main.cf。根据您的需求编辑此文件中的相关参数,如myhostname、mydomain、inet_interfaces、relayhost等。
三、重启服务
完成上述步骤后,记得重启Postfix服务以使更改生效。
MacOS系统上的SMTP服务器客户端配置
macOS也支持SMTP服务,但是自macOS Sierra起已不再默认提供该服务。您仍然可以通过以下方法设置:
一、使用Mail程序
Mac自带的Mail应用程序允许用户轻松地配置SMTP账户。只需打开Mail程序,然后转到“偏好设置”->“帐户”,点击“+”按钮添加新的电子邮件账户,并按照提示填写信息即可。
二、借助Homebrew安装SMTP服务
如果希望拥有完整的SMTP服务器,则可以通过Homebrew安装Postfix。具体操作为:先安装Homebrew,之后运行“brew install postfix”。接下来参照Linux部分指导对Postfix进行相应配置。
在不同操作系统上配置SMTP服务器客户端的方法各有差异,但总体思路相似。无论是Windows、Linux还是MacOS,都需要确保正确安装和配置SMTP服务,同时注意网络安全防护措施。希望本文能够帮助大家更好地理解和掌握这一技能。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/76350.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。